Output d995a93f5173624b33bd5d131cf21d47fa9b5a0df32f070341ffe1d7669e3ec7:1

value
3249786185
script pubkey
OP_0 OP_PUSHBYTES_20 3173f6690b6c0893eaceaf10d7171bbfe7cec0eb
address
tb1qx9elv6gtdsyf86kw4ugdw9cmhlnuas8tm7vge9
transaction
d995a93f5173624b33bd5d131cf21d47fa9b5a0df32f070341ffe1d7669e3ec7
confirmations
58465
spent
true